I did some testing on the GMT400 condenser pusher fan like the one my 1999 Tahoe came with from GM. I recently added one to the 1987 G20 van. Ended up dropping the vent temps about 5°F at idle as well as reducing some of the stress on the a/c compressor. I have the relay that controls the fan tied into the high blower fan relay turn on signal from the blower motor speed control switch. When I flip the interior blower fan to high speed, it turns on the fan. Later on I will deligate control of the fan to the P59 PCM.

Here is a clip of the testing. With everything heat soaked, it took about 4-5 minutes for it to provide the lowest presaures and coolest air. That being said the pressures started dropping immediately when I activated it.

This is interesting! I'm currently driving an '05 vw passat tdi wagon. While it has an engine driven mechanical fan, it also has an electric fan beside the engine driven one. This engine doesn't run hot enough to know if it would come on to assist with engine cooling, but it does run when the a/c is on, and a/c pressures reach a pre-set point. This seems to happen sitting still at idle. It does keep idle a/c cooling very consistent, no noticeable difference in vent temps from idle to cruising.
Of course, at this point I have no gauges, so exact parameters are unknown.
I like the idea of your pusher fan. It's a method that will help the idle/no vehicular movement a/c vent temps.
